Verse 23
1 Corinthians 10:23
World English Bible, British Edition
23
“All things are lawful for me,” but not all things are profitable.
“All things are lawful for me,” but not all things build up.
Original Language Text
greek
⸀Πάντα ἔξεστιν· ἀλλ’ οὐ πάντα συμφέρει. ⸁πάντα ἔξεστιν· ἀλλ’ οὐ πάντα οἰκοδομεῖ.
English Translation
All things are permitted; but not all things are beneficial. All things are permitted; but not all things build up.
